Web21 okt. 2024 · The ability to eradicate poverty is the single biggest predictor of good health. In other words, eradicating poverty is more important for improving the health of Malaysians than building more hospitals or training more doctors. The converse is also true, that the single best predictor of poorer health is poverty. WebAs normally defined, “poverty” means that one cannot afford certain pre-determined consumption needs.
